Infrared Hotplate 42-IHP102 is a corrosion resistant ceramic glass plate with transmittance of infrared light for faster and uniform heating of sample. With a resistance of thermal shock upto 700 °C it boils 1 L of water within 10 minutes. Features an LCD screen displaying preset and actual temperature for monitoring of process. High-temperature indicator warns the user preventing burning injuries.

Specifications
| Display mode | LCD |
| Heating power | 1.8 kW |
| Time to boil 1 L H20 | 7 mins |
| Heating zone | ᴓ 190 mm |
| Maximum capacity | 25 L |
| Maximum hotplate temperature | 550 °C |
| Top plate area ( W x L ) | 285 x 285 mm |
| Top plate material | Glass ceramic |
| Temperature sensor connector | Yes |
| Admissible ambient temperature | 10 °C to 40 °C |
| Admissible air humidity | 0.85 |
| Protection category | IP20 |
| Protection class | 1 |
| Dimensions | 395 x 295 x 110 mm |

Applications
Infrared Hotplate is used to uniformly heat samples and to heat glassware in a laboratory setting
Lab Expo infrared hot plates use ceramic glass plates for durability. They disperse infrared light, which heats everything quickly and evenly. These hotplates include digital temperature displays that are simple to read. They both heat up and cool down fast. Their surface is strong and resistant to corrosion.
